U.S. Energy Development Corporation Announces Key Promotions
U.S. Energy Development Corporation (USEDC), a distinguished exploration and production company based in Fort Worth, Texas, has made significant strides by appointing Matthew Iak as the new President of Capital Markets. This move comes as a part of a series of high-level promotions aimed at reinforcing the company's strategy and operational excellence in the capital markets sector.
Matthew Iak's Leadership Background
Matthew Iak's appointment highlights his exceptional commitment and leadership within the organization since he joined USEDC in 2005. With over two decades of experience, Iak has been integral in developing innovative oil and gas investment vehicles that have firmly established USEDC's reputation as a trusted partner in the industry. His leadership of the capital markets group has been particularly influential, enabling the company to deploy over $3 billion in capital for itself and its partners, underscoring his strategic investment acumen.

Strategic Promotions at USEDC
With Iak's transition to President of Capital Markets, several key executives have also been recognized for their contributions: Michael Haven has been promoted to Senior Vice President, Capital Markets; Todd Witmer has taken on the role of Senior Vice President, Corporate Development; and Josh Dazey has been appointed as Senior Vice President and General Counsel. These promotions are part of U.S. Energy's broader strategy to ensure that experienced leaders guide the organization in its future pursuits.

About U.S. Energy Development Corporation
Founded in 1980, USEDC has become a prominent privately-held exploration and production firm. Over the past four decades, it has invested in and operated approximately 4,000 wells across multiple states and Canada.
